Key Specifications
| Specification | Value |
|---|---|
| Standard | WiFi 7 (802.11be) |
| Throughput | Up to 19 Gbps |
| Bands | Tri-band: 2.4 + 5 + 6 GHz |
| Ports | 2× 10G + 4× 2.5G Ethernet |
| MLO | Multi-Link Operation supported |
| Devices | 200+ simultaneous |

Pros & Cons
Pros:
- WiFi 7 MLO bonds multiple bands for dramatically lower latency and higher speed
- Supports 200+ devices — ideal for dense smart home setups
- 10G WAN port is future-proof for multi-gigabit internet connections
- 6GHz band provides clean, interference-free spectrum for modern devices
Cons:
- $250 is expensive for a router — overkill for most households
- Few WiFi 7 client devices exist as of early 2026
- Large physical size may not fit in entertainment center shelves
User Feedback from Chinese Review Platforms
We analyzed reviews from JD.com, Taobao, and Xiaohongshu for authentic user perspectives.
Positive Reviews
“Upgrading from WiFi 6 to WiFi 7 cut my wireless VR latency in half. Air Link to my Quest 3 is now indistinguishable from wired. The 6GHz band is completely clean — zero interference from neighbors.”
— JD.com, vr_wireless
“I manage 80+ smart home devices, 4 streaming TVs, and 3 gaming PCs — this router handles everything without breaking a sweat. The 2.5G Ethernet ports mean my NAS and gaming PC get wired speeds that saturate my drives.”
— Xiaohongshu, smart_home_army
“Multi-Link Operation (MLO) is the real WiFi 7 killer feature — my phone simultaneously uses 5GHz and 6GHz bands for downloads that max out my gigabit fiber connection. WiFi that finally beats Ethernet.”
— Taobao, mlo_believer
Critical Feedback
“$250 is a lot for a router that most people won’t fully utilize. Unless you have gigabit+ internet and 50+ devices, a $100 WiFi 6 router will serve you just as well for the foreseeable future.”
— SMZDM, overkill
“It’s genuinely large — roughly the size of a gaming console. Doesn’t fit in my media cabinet and sits awkwardly on top. The spider-like design with 8 antennas is not spouse-approved decor.”
— JD.com, router_monster
Common praise themes: WiFi 7 MLO performance, 200+ device capacity, 10G future-proofing
Common concerns: $250 overkill for most, limited WiFi 7 clients, physically enormous
